T-WRECKS
First Appearance:
Ballz (1994)
Role: Tiny T-Rex
PL 6 (59)
STRENGTH
6 STAMINA 7 AGILITY 2
FIGHTING 5 DEXTERITY 2
INTELLIGENCE -3 AWARENESS 0 PRESENCE -2

Skills:
Athletics 3 (+6)
Expertise (Survival) 4 (+4)
Intimidation 8 (+6, +8 Size)
Perception 3 (+3)

Advantages:
Close Attack, Improved Hold

Fighting With Ballz: All-Out Attack, Fast Grab (Grab), Improved Critical (Unarmed), Improved Defense, Improved Trip (Throw)

Powers:
"Ground Pound" Damage 2 (Extras: Area- 30ft. Burst) (Flaws: Limited to Grounded Targets) Linked to Affliction 5 (Athletics; Hindered & Vulnerable/Immobile & Defenseless) (Extras: Extra Condition, Area- 30ft. Burst) (Flaws: Distracting, Limited Degree, Instant Recovery) (5) -- [7]
  • AE: "Special Moves" Strength-Damage +2 (Feats: Reach) (Inaccurate -1) (2)
  • AE: "Rapid Bite" Strength-Damage +0 (Extras: Multiattack 6) (Reduced Defenses -2) (2)
Growth 4 (Str & Sta +4, +4 Mass, +2 Intimidation, -2 Dodge/Parry, -4 Stealth) -- (15 feet) (Feats: Innate) (Extras: Permanent +0) [9]
"Animal Senses" Senses 4 (Low-Light Vision, Acute Scent & Extended Scent 2) [4]

Offense:
Unarmed +5 (+6 Damage, DC 21)
Special Moves +3 (+8 Damage, DC 23)
Ground Pound +2-5 Area (+2 Damage & +5 Affliction, DC 17 & 15)
Initiative +2

Defenses:
Dodge +3 (DC 13), Parry +4 (DC 14), Toughness +7, Fortitude +6, Will +3

Complications:
Prejudice (Made of Balls)
Disabled (Animal)- Dinosaurs cannot speak to humans, nor use their limbs to easily manipulate objects.

Total: Abilities: 18 / Skills: 18--9 / Advantages: 2 + 5 / Powers: 20 / Defenses: 7 (59)

-This is actually pretty original- one of the first bosses you meet is a FRIGGIN' T-REX, its head made of three balls- it takes a proper Theropod-like pose, and rapidly bites at enemies. It's also twice as big as any other character.

BOUNDER
First Appearance:
Ballz (1994)
Role: Fighting Kangaroo
PL 5 (53)
STRENGTH
3 STAMINA 3 AGILITY 4
FIGHTING 7 DEXTERITY 2
INTELLIGENCE -3 AWARENESS 0 PRESENCE -2

Skills:
Athletics 3 (+7)
Expertise (Survival) 5 (+5)

Advantages:
Improved Critical (Unarmed- total 2), Improved Initiative

Fighting With Ballz: All-Out Attack, Fast Grab (Grab), Improved Critical (Unarmed), Improved Defense, Improved Trip (Throw)

Powers:
"Tail Strike" Strength-Damage +2 (Feats: Reach 2) (Inaccurate -1) [3]
"Animal Senses" Senses 3 (Acute & Extended Scent, Low-Light Vision) [3]
Leaping 2 (30 feet) [2]

Offense:
Unarmed +7 (+3 Damage, DC 18)
Special Moves +5 (+5 Damage, DC 20)
Initiative +8

Defenses:
Dodge +6 (DC 16), Parry +7 (DC 17), Toughness +3, Fortitude +4, Will +3

Complications:
Prejudice (Made of Balls)
Disabled (Animal)- Kangaroos cannot speak to humans, nor use their limbs to easily manipulate objects.

Total: Abilities: 28 / Skills: 8--4 / Advantages: 2 + 5 / Powers: 8 / Defenses: 6 (53)

-Pre-dating Tekken's Roger by a few years, Bounder is another boxing kangaroo, but the simplicity of its "ball-head" makes it look more lizard-like. He jumps REALLY high, and hits with a tail attack that works kind of like a scorpion's sting- curling directly overhead.

From what I found it started around 1891, with a panel in an Australian "penny dreadful" style magazine. The inspiration came from the typical defensive stance used by wild kangaroos to fend off their opponents, which looks pretty similar to a boxing stance.

LAMPREY
First Appearance:
Ballz (1994)
Role: Shapeshifter
PL 6 (69)
STRENGTH
5 STAMINA 5 AGILITY 4
FIGHTING 7 DEXTERITY 2
INTELLIGENCE -3 AWARENESS 0 PRESENCE -2

Skills:
Athletics 3 (+7)
Expertise (Survival) 5 (+5)

Advantages:
Improved Critical (Unarmed- total 2), Improved Initiative

Fighting With Ballz: All-Out Attack, Fast Grab (Grab), Improved Critical (Unarmed), Improved Defense, Improved Trip (Throw)

Powers:
"Spike- Scorpion Form"
"Scorpion Tail Strike" Strength-Damage +2 (Feats: Reach 2) (Extras: Penetrating 2) (Inaccurate -1) [5]
"Animal Senses" Senses 3 (Acute & Extended Scent, Low-Light Vision) [3]

"Byte Viper- Snake Form" Morph 1 (Feats: Metamorph- Swaps Tail with Slithering, Chokehold & Improved Hold) (6) -- [8]
  • AE: "El Ballz- Bull Form" Morph 1 (Feats: Metamorph- ST & STA +1, FIGHTING -1) (6)
  • AE: "Genie Form- Baseline" Morph 1 (Feats: Metamorph- Flight 1- Hovering) (6)
Offense:
Unarmed +7 (+5 Damage, DC 20)
Special Moves +5 (+7 Damage, DC 22)
Initiative +8

Defenses:
Dodge +6 (DC 16), Parry +7 (DC 17), Toughness +5, Fortitude +6, Will +3

Complications:
Prejudice (Made of Balls)

Total: Abilities: 36 / Skills: 8--4 / Advantages: 2 + 5 / Powers: 16 / Defenses: 6 (69)

-Lamprey has one of the more interesting and cool concepts for a throwaway Fighting Game fighter- he's a shapeshifter who turns into animals, presenting multiple kinds of threats. Given the limitations on cast sizes (especially for games in 1993), you can see why they don't try that one very often. Apparently he's a genie, but typically he takes the form of a bull, snake, or scorpion, each one offering slightly different traits.

JESTER
First Appearance:
Ballz (1994)
Role: The Final Boss
PL 6 (109)
STRENGTH
4 STAMINA 4 AGILITY 5
FIGHTING 8 DEXTERITY 2
INTELLIGENCE 1 AWARENESS 1 PRESENCE 3

Skills:
Acrobatics 7 (+12)
Athletics 6 (+10)
Expertise (Jesting) 4 (+7)
Perception 1 (+2)

Advantages:
Agile Feint, Close Attack, Improved Initiative, Ranged Attack 2

Fighting With Ballz: All-Out Attack, Fast Grab (Grab), Improved Critical (Unarmed), Improved Defense, Improved Trip (Throw)

Powers:
"Thrown Ball" Blast 4 (Feats: Accurate 2) (Diminished Range -1) (9) -- [10]
  • AE: "Special Moves" Strength-Damage +2 (Inaccurate -1) (1)
"Reform From Near-Death" Regeneration 8 Linked to Damage 4 (Extras: Reaction +3, Area- 15ft. Burst +1/2) (Flaws: Unreliable- 1/day -3) [14]

"Fall To Balls"
Movement 1 (Slithering) [2]
Speed 1 (4 mph) [1]

Offense:
Unarmed +8 (+4 Damage, DC 19)
Special Moves +6 (+6 Damage, DC 21)
Thrown Ball +6 (+4 Ranged Damage, DC 19)
Initiative +9

Defenses:
Dodge +7 (DC 17), Parry +8 (DC 18), Toughness +4, Fortitude +4, Will +3

Complications:
Prejudice (Made of Balls)

Total: Abilities: 56 / Skills: 18--9 / Advantages: 5 + 5 / Powers: 27 / Defenses: 7 (109)

-Jester is the white & black-colored Final Boss, looking more like a generic character if not for his color scheme. He's hard to defeat, being able to counter most of your attacks with grabs of his own, and he can fall into a pile of balls and "slide" across the floor. One of his other techniques is to reform after you knock the crap out of him- he springs back from a pile of balls, and hurts you if you're too close, healing along the way. I statted it up as a separate thing, since it's a Reaction, but its heavily limited since it only happens once- a neat trick that evens out the cost, so it's just Regeneration + Area Damage in cost.
